Understanding Galvanizing Lines

Galvanizing lines are specialized production units designed to coat steel and iron with a layer of zinc. This coating protects metals from corrosion, making galvanizing a critical step in manufacturing products meant for outdoor use or harsh environments. By adopting a galvanizing line, companies can increase their product reliability while minimizing maintenance costs.

The Benefits of Investing in Galvanizing Lines

For manufacturers, implementing a galvanizing line capital investment can yield significant returns. A key advantage is the improved quality of finished products, as the zinc coating provides a protective barrier that enhances the material's resistance to rust and corrosion. This not only boosts customer satisfaction but also reduces the likelihood of warranty claims and product recalls.

Moreover, a well-implemented galvanizing process can lead to operational efficiencies. Modern galvanizing lines are typically designed with automation in mind, which reduces labor costs and minimizes human error. Enhanced automation also allows for faster production cycles, enabling companies to meet demand more effectively.

Sustainability and Environmental Impact

In addition to economic benefits, galvanizing lines can contribute positively to environmental sustainability. Zinc, a naturally occurring resource, is not only recyclable but can also help enhance the longevity of metal products, ultimately reducing the need for frequent replacements. This aligns with the growing consumer demand for sustainable practices in manufacturing.
